Gray (Walderstown) St. George Gray was among the principal lessors in the parish of Drumraney, barony of Kilkenny West, County Westmeath at the time of Griffiths Valuation. In the 1870s William H. Gray of Dorrington, Drumraney, was the owner of over 1200 acres in the county. O'Brien provides an outline of the history of this family, suggesting that they may originally have had Scottish ancestry and acquired their interest in this Westmeath estate by inheritance from John Dorrington Hackett.
